Identification | Back Directory | [Name]
TRI(PROPYLENE GLYCOL) BUTYL ETHER | [CAS]
55934-93-5 | [Synonyms]
TPNB dowanol tpnb DOWANOL(TM) TPNB DOWANOL(R) TPnB ARCOSOLV (R) TPNB PPG-3 BUTYL ETHER Tripropyleneglycoln-butylether Tripropyleneglycolmonobutylether TRI(PROPYLENE GLYCOL) BUTYL ETHER TRIPROPYLENEGLYCOL(MONO)N-BUTYLETHER TRIPROPYLENE GLYCOL NORMAL BUTYL ETHER tri(propyleneglycol)butylether,mixtureo [(Butoxymethylethoxy)methylethoxy]propan-2-ol [(butoxymethylethoxy)methylethoxy]propan-1-ol [2-(2-butoxymethylethoxy)methylethoxy]-propano [2-(2-butoxymethylethoxy)methylethoxy]-Propanol Propanol, 2-(2-butoxymethylethoxy)methylethoxy- Tri(propylene glycol) butyl ether,mixture of isomers Tri(propylene glycol) butyl ether, Mixture of isoMers 95% TRI(PROPYLENE GLYCOL) BUTYL ETHER, 95%, MIXTURE OF ISOMERS Tri(propylene glycol) butyl ether, Mixture of isoMers >=95% TRI(PROPYLENE GLYCOL) BUTYL ETHER, 95+%, MIXTURE OF ISOMERS (DOWANOL TPNB) | [EINECS(EC#)]
259-910-3 | [Molecular Formula]
C13H28O4 | [MDL Number]
MFCD00216640 | [MOL File]
55934-93-5.mol | [Molecular Weight]
248.36 |
